Located in Riverside County, California, Coachella is a community with a population of 42,594. At $67,558, its median household income sits below Riverside County's $89,672.

From 2019 to 2023, Coachella's population declined 5.7% from 45,181 to 42,594, while its median home value rose 55.6% from $219,400 to $341,300.

Households average 3.45 people. The median gross rent is $1,115.
